When is the best time of year for a romantic getaway to Pozzuoli?
If you’re hoping to get lost in the rain on your romantic getaway, check out these details about year-round temperatures in Pozzuoli: The hottest months are usually August and July with an average temp of 76°F, while the coldest months are January and February with an average of 50°F. Average annual precipitation for Pozzuoli is 50 inches.

What's the best way to get to Pozzuoli and around town during my romantic getaway?
These transportation options in Pozzuoli might help your romantic trip go off without a hitch: If you’re looking to fly to Pozzuoli, the closest major airport is Naples Intl. Airport (NAP), located 10.1 mi (16.3 km) from the city center. Nearby metro stations include Lucrino Station, Cantieri Station, and Via Campana Station.
